New Surgeon Continues Family Legacy of Orthopedic Care

November 2, 2022

Dr. Michael Giovan grew up listening to his father, an orthopedic physician of 30 years, talk about interesting and challenging cases. Observing firsthand how much his own father enjoyed his work prepared Dr. Giovan to pursue a path in orthopedics and recently join Mercy Clinic Orthopedic Surgery – Ada.

“Orthopedics is a great field because we generally work with conditions or injuries that are treatable,” said Dr. Giovan. “I’m passionate about living an active lifestyle, and it’s very rewarding to hear a patient’s story and then help them get back to what they love after an injury.”

Dr. Giovan brings more than 16 years of experience in orthopedic and sports medicine with a focus in shoulder injuries. He spent an extra year of fellowship training to learn more about advanced shoulder surgical procedures, allowing him to expand his expertise in total shoulder and reverse total shoulder reconstruction and replacement.

“As a child, I was always working with my hands, either assembling models or tinkering with remote cars,” said Dr. Giovan. “This career gives me the chance to apply what I love and make a real impact.”

Originally from Santa Rosa, California, Dr. Giovan felt drawn to practice in a rural community like Ada where he could develop closer relationships with patients and the community. In his spare time, he enjoys playing golf and hiking. Growing up in California’s wine country also fostered his love for collecting wine.

Dr. Giovan said, “We want patients to know that they don’t have to travel out of town to find high-quality expertise and fellowship-level care. We can provide it close to home.”

Dr. Giovan earned a bachelor’s in molecular and cell biology from the University of California, Berkley, and a medical degree from George Washington University School of Medicine in Washington D.C. 

He later completed an orthopedic surgery residency at Maricopa Integrated Health System in Phoenix, Arizona and a fellowship in shoulder and sports medicine at The CORE Institute in Sun City West, Arizona.
